Back in 2000, we helped establish the Global Diversity Network - a group of leading global organisations working together on diversity and inclusion issues and learning from each others ideas, initiatives and best practices. During its 10 years members have worked together in a variety of different ways - with face to face meetings, conference calls and generating benchmarking and research reports. At the heart of all these activities has been a joint commitment to making progress on diversity and inclusion in a global environment and an openness to share experience and help others avoid having to learn the lessons the hard way.
In October, current and past members of the Network along with organisations who are keen to be involved in the future, will be meeting to celebrate the last decade and share best practice case studies on Day 1. Day 2 of the meeting will be an opportunity to agree a new way of working for the GDN. We believe the days when there could be a common annual programme to which all members signed up are past and we are proposing a new project-driven approach. This will enable members to focus on issues that are of most concern to their business; bring in new organisations who have a mutual interest in these topics and provide access to Schneider~Ross consultancy and support as and when required. As has been the case for several years, this will continue to be on a not for profit basis.
